Soviet Occupation Zone, East Saxony, 4 Reichsmark (Numbers series)

Soviet Occupation Zone, Germany · 1945 · 4 RM

The stamp features a large numeral '4' in the center, denoting its denomination, with 'RM' below it. 'DEUTSCHE POST' is inscribed at the top within a simple rectangular frame.

Issued in 1945, this stamp belongs to a provisional series used in the Soviet Occupation Zone of Germany, specifically East Saxony, to re-establish postal services immediately following World War II.
